| Nhat Tam Temple (Chua Nhat Tam) is a Buddhist temple located in the district of Quan 12 in Ho Chi Minh City, Vietnam. The temple was built in 2008 and has since become a popular spiritual destination for both locals and tourists. | |
| The temple grounds consist of several buildings, including a main hall, apagoda, and abell tower. The main hall is decorated with intricate carvings and features a large statue of Buddha. Visitors can also see smaller statues of other Buddhist deities inside the temple. Outside the temple, there is aspacious courtyard where visitors can relax and meditate. The areais surrounded by lush gardens and ponds filled with lotus flowers. There is also avegetarian restaurant on the premises that serves delicious Vietnamese cuisine. Nhat Tam Temple is a peaceful and tranquil place that offers visitors achance to escape the hustle and bustle of city life.
